Drainage Trench Installation in Atlanta, GA
Drainage trench installation is a service that involves creating a shallow, excavated channel designed to direct excess water away from specific areas of a property. This type of project is commonly requested for managing stormwater runoff, preventing flooding in yards or basements, and improving overall drainage around homes and commercial properties. Property owners typically want to understand the appropriate locations for trenches, the materials used, and how the system will effectively control water flow to protect landscaping, foundations, and other structures.
Before requesting drainage trench installation, property owners should consider factors such as the property's slope, existing drainage issues, and the intended purpose of the system. It’s important to evaluate the surrounding landscape to determine the best placement for trenches and ensure proper connection to existing drainage solutions or municipal systems. Clear communication about the scope of the project, the type of soil, and any potential obstructions can help facilitate a smooth installation process and ensure the drainage system functions effectively over time.

Drainage Trench Installation Questions
What is a drainage trench? A drainage trench is a shallow, narrow channel installed to redirect excess water away from a property, helping prevent flooding and water damage.
When should drainage trenches be installed? They are typically used when there is persistent surface water, poor drainage, or to protect foundations from water pooling around the property.
What materials are used for drainage trenches? Common materials include perforated pipes, gravel, and filter fabric, which work together to facilitate effective water flow and prevent clogging.
Are drainage trenches suitable for all property types? They are effective for various property types, especially where grading or natural drainage is insufficient to manage water runoff.
